Coopers Knob from Hoon Hay Reserve 2023

Leaders, photos and report: Denise and Ken

With a fairly uncertain weather forecast and lots of fog, 11 keen walkers met at Hoon Hay Reserve carpark.  We set off not being able to see very far in any direction.  We had two friendly sheep who joined our line of walkers for the first part of the walk.

We stopped at the Sign of the Bellbird for morning tea – still without a view!

The next part of the track was muddy and slippery but lovely with the bark on the fuchsia trees looking beautiful after the rain. We carried on towards Coopers Knob but made a mutual decision not to go to the top as by then there was a cold wind blowing and there would be nothing to see but cloud.

We climbed a stile and found a sheltered spot for lunch where the clouds parted for a short time and gave us a view of the harbour. We got some glimpses of the city and surrounds on our return walk.  A great day was had by all!
